Is Celebration Cake Gelato Gluten Free?

No. This product is not gluten free as it lists 2 ingredients that contain gluten and 1 ingredient that could contain gluten depending on the source. We recommend contacting the manufacturer directly to confirm.

Ingredients

MILK (WATER, NONFAT DRIED MILK POWDER, HEAVY CREAM), CANE SUGAR, CAKE PIECES (SUGAR, ENRICHED WHEAT FLOUR [WHEAT FLOUR, NIACIN, REDUCED IRON, THIAMINE MONONITRATE, RIBOFLAVIN, FOLIC ACID], PALM OIL, WATER, NONFAT MILK, BAKING POWDER [SODIUM ACID PYROPHOSPHATE, CORNSTARCH, SODIUM BICARBONATE, MONOCALCIUM PHOSPHATE], EGG WHITES, SEA SALT, NATURAL FLAVOR), RAINBOW SPRINKLES (SUGAR, VEGETABLE OIL [PALM KERNEL AND PALM OIL], CORNSTARCH, VEGETABLE JUICE [COLOR], SUNFLOWER LECITHIN, COLOR ADDED [ANNATTO EXTRACT, SPIRULINA EXTRACT, TURMERIC, BETA-CAROTENE, PAPRIKA OLEORESIN], MALTODEXTRIN, CARNAUBA WAX, CELLULOSE GUM), COCONUT OIL, DEXTROSE, CONTAINS 2% OR LESS OF CHICORY ROOT FIBER, EGG YOLK, BUTTER (CREAM, NATURAL FLAVOR), WHEY PROTEIN CONCENTRATE, MONO- AND DIGLYCERIDES OF FATTY ACIDS, CREAM CHEESE SOLIDS (CREAM CHEESE [PASTEURIZED MILK, CHEESE CULTURE, SALT, CAROB BEAN GUM], NONFAT MILK), NATURAL FLAVORS, SEA SALT, CAROB BEAN GUM, GUAR GUM, ANNATTO EXTRACT [COLOR]).

What is a Gluten Free diet?

A gluten-free diet excludes all foods containing gluten, a protein found in wheat, barley, rye, and their derivatives. It's essential for people with celiac disease, gluten intolerance, or wheat allergy, as consuming gluten can trigger inflammation and digestive issues. Common gluten-containing foods include bread, pasta, cereals, and baked goods, though many gluten-free alternatives now exist using rice, corn, or almond flour. Beyond medical necessity, some people choose a gluten-free lifestyle for perceived health benefits, though experts emphasize the importance of maintaining a balanced diet rich in fiber, vitamins, and minerals when eliminating gluten-containing grains.
